**Q: Why do bulk edits in the Ternwick admin table sometimes silently skip rows?**

Short version: rows locked by another session get skipped, and the toast doesn't mention it. Yeah, we know. Until the fix lands, run bulk edits during low traffic and check the audit log after. If the edit queue itself gets wedged, you'll need to unlock the maintenance vault, which requires the recovery passphrase below.

strongbox words: briiel-zoreth-noveth-pelys-druwyn-feniel-lamvan-ulaius-kasion

Subject: Ledger pick-up Thursday

Hi dispatch team,

The quarterly stock-count ledger for Tovren Stores is boxed and waiting at the records counter. It needs to go out with Thursday's courier run to the Ashfield archive — nothing else ships with it. Please log the seal number before release. When the courier signs for it, pass on this confidential instruction:

handover note for yagef-bagep: the drudor pelius courier leaves the kasdor zorvan norir ledger at gate 8016 under passcode 755406

Ticket: Orders marked soft-deleted in Cartwheel's orders table still appear in the nightly reconciliation export. The deleted_at filter is missing from the export query, not the API layer, so customer-facing views are fine. On-call: suppress tonight's export alert and flag finance. Fix is staged; the candidate build is identified by the token below.

session token of tajef-bageg = htk21_5d90d574934f3ccae6437